LITTLE KIDS, BIG WORLD: STAYING WARM IN WINTER CLOTHING

Toddlers and preschoolers are invited to this free interactive learning series where they will look at all the different winter clothing in the State Museum and decorate their own mittens. These interactive 30-minute programs introduce children to North Dakota’s fascinating history. All children must be accompanied by a parent or guardian and are asked to meet at the east entrance information desk. "Little Kids, Big World" is led by Sarah Fox, who has teaching endorsements in STEM 1-8, middle school 5-8, and kindergarten, and has taught for more than 10 years.
